Pulse and Vibration modules

Single and dual channel modules are available to transfer vibration probe signals from
a hazardous area to a safe one. Similarly, pulses from a switch, proximity detector, current
pulse transmitter or voltage pulse transmitter, located in the hazardous area, can be safely
transferred to the safe area.

MTL4531 - Vibration Transducer Interface

Single channel
The MTL4531 repeats a signal from a vibration sensor in a hazardous area, providing an
output for a monitoring system in the safe area. The interface is compatible with 3-wire,
eddy-current probes and accelerometers or 2-wire current sensors, and selection of the
mode is made with a switch located on the side of the module.
